Christian rock band Unspoken has released its new single "Wild Ones," out now on all streaming platforms. The song centers on the idea that everyone is "prone to wander" from God's standard, and that Jesus came specifically to seek out those who feel too far gone to be found.
"This new song is a reminder that every one of us is prone to wander," the band shared in a statement announcing the release. "We've all fallen short of God's glorious standard, but that's exactly why He sent His one and only Son, Jesus-to seek and save the wild ones. No one is too far gone, too broken, or too lost for His love. Jesus is still chasing down prodigals, welcoming outcasts, and calling every wandering heart home."
"Wild Ones" arrives as Unspoken continues touring in support of recent music, following the band's 2024 studio album IV, its first full-length project in more than five years. Formed by singer Chad Mattson and guitarist Mike Gomez after the two met on a missionary trip to the Dominican Republic, Unspoken has built a catalog of Christian radio staples including "Start a Fire," "Call It Grace," and "Just Give Me Jesus."
